Output 3613d95cdda21c5380c54931b5258119572c128251fe61f716ce8bd4c83784da:0

value
1786660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e820bfd5b51f901c81d4960a843c7abb7190a2c OP_EQUAL
address
3DDvrXWdt254LKXyunaAz6HLUkkj9fsKwu
transaction
3613d95cdda21c5380c54931b5258119572c128251fe61f716ce8bd4c83784da
spent
true